Dorothy “Dot” Moore, FNP
Moore received her Bachelor of Science in nursing from University Medical Center School of Nursing in Jackson, Miss. and her Master of Science in nursing from The University of Southern Mississippi in Hattiesburg, Miss. She is certified as a family nurse practitioner by the American Nurses Credentialing Center and a registered nurse by the Mississippi Board of Nursing. Moore is a member of the American Nurses’ Association, the Mississippi Nurses’ Association and Sigma Theta Tau International Honor Society of Nursing.
Moore has nursing experience in spinal cord injured patients, labor and delivery, and orthopaedics. As a nurse practitioner in Physical Medicine & Rehabilitation, she specializes in disorders of the spine and neurology.
ABOUT PHYSICAL MEDICINE AND REHABILITATION
Physical Medicine & Rehabilitation providers are nerve, muscle and bone experts who treat injuries or illnesses that affect how you move and function. They have completed training in the medical specialty physical medicine and rehabilitation (PM&R).
